ADOT’s Mesa conference focuses on disadvantaged, small businesses
(ADOT)
Arizona Department of Transportation meeting in Mesa is scheduled to help small businesses.
Posted
INDEPENDENT NEWSMEDIA
An Arizona Department of Transportation event scheduled for Tuesday, Oct. 22, is designed to help small businesses and firms qualifying for ADOT’s Disadvantaged Business Enterprise Program compete for contracts in the transportation industry.
The theme of the session is Bridging Inclusive Growth, and the conference will take place at the Delta Hotel in Mesa, featuring opportunities for networking, discussions with contractors, one-on-one appointments with buying agencies and contractors, educational breakout sessions and opportunities to learn about ADOT programs designed to help build businesses, according to a release.
